They are developed for usage mainly on smooth roads, reduced speeds/distances, as well as are included in the non-racing/non-touring course and heavyweight or middleweight styles of the roadway bike type. The bikes, noted for their longevity and also hefty weight, were the most popular bike in the USA from the early 1930s with the 1950s, and also have actually delighted in restored popularity because the late 1990s. The Crusader "Cruiser" model was the high-end men/boy's bicycle, and also consisted of extra features, such as front headlight, back rack, and also most notably, the motorcycle container. The low-end version, (likewise described in advertisements' small print as a cruiser), was the crusader "chaser," as well as the ladies' the crusader "clipper" and also 'cutter" versions to complete the maritime motif in the product calling plan.
Navy Cruiser ships were illustrated in the Mead Cycle Co. ads. "cruiser" may have come from as one version name made use of by one supplier of the motorbike design of bicycles. The term beach-ranger never ever actually caught on. In an old magazine from Sears, Roebuck and Firm, the Elgin Motor Bike was promoted, as well as the click over here term motor-bike was clarified as adheres to, "The term "Moto-Bike" has reference only to the kind of framework, suggesting that it is improved the order of a motorbike".
bike sales had actually declined dramatically because of the Great Depression; adults purchased couple of bikes, which were seen as high-end items meant largely for sporting activity or recreation. In feedback to other suppliers' developments, Schwinn conceived their very own sturdy, budget-friendly bike developed for the a lot more resilient youth marketoriginally marketing the Schwinn B-10E Motorbikewhich resembled a bike but brought no motorin 1933 - best cruiser bikes.

Schwinn adjusted functions from the Henderson as well as Excelsior motorbikes that his (previously bought) bankrupt company had actually constructed during the 1920s, including a heavy "cantilevered" frame with 2 leading tubes and also 2. Schwinn, like others, copied what they saw going on in Europe.
As well as the enhance motion in bicycles was actually originated by Sears and also Huffman. The resulting bicycles could endure misuse that could damage others. In 1934, Schwinn successfully re-styled the B-10E, renaming it the Aero Cycle. While the Aero Cycle featured no technological improvements over the original B-10E, its streamlined framework, fake gas container, and also battery-powered headlight involved define the cruiser 'look'.
Schwinn is attributed with kicking off the balloon tire trend when they presented their offerings for 1933. By 1954, the balloon tire was tired and on its means out. That's when Schwinn introduced the middleweight - Huffy bikes. All various other producers did the same in quick succession. The middleweights would certainly last well right into the 1970s.
